Abstract
In obese (fa/fa) rats both the total (-)-isoprenaline- and NaF-stimulated adenylate cyclase activities of interscapular brown-adipose-tissue (IBAT) plasma membranes were decreased as compared with lean rats by 40 and 38% respectively. An acute treatment with Roi 16-8714 increased(-)-isoprenaline- and NaF-stimulated adenylate cyclase activities by 2.5- to 2.0-fold respectively, and .beta.-adrenoceptor number 2.8-fold in obese rat IBAT, but it had no effect on these parameters in lean rats.
